Enterprise Survey
Synology 2025 Enterprise Survey revealed UAE’s Critical gaps in cyber resilience.
Amid increasing IT complexity, the Synology 2025 Enterprise Survey reveals that many organizations in the MEA region remain vulnerable to cyber risks:
- Fewer than 18% of enterprises are confident in addressing rising cyber threats, while 32% experienced data loss or security incidents in the past year.
- 84% of IT leaders prioritize security in IT infrastructure, underscoring the demand for trusted solutions.
- 55% of businesses cite data protection and disaster recovery as the main drivers of data growth in the coming year, highlighting the importance of scalable storage for business continuity.
- Despite awareness of the need for resilience, 63.52% of IT leaders struggle with cost challenges in maintaining continuity.
These findings underscore the urgent need for comprehensive cyber resilience strategies that safeguard data, maintain continuity, and simplify IT management.
Showcasing solutions
At the event, Synology showcased its enterprise storage solutions, including the high-performance PAS Series with active-active dual controllers and end-to-end NVMe (Non-Volatile Memory Express) technology, designed to deliver performance meeting high availability.
With the recent release of DP7200 and APM1.1, Synology unveiled new ActiveProtect updates that deliver expanded workload support, strengthened cyber resilience, and simplified compliance.
